Harnessing Queensland’s Solar Advantage With Glamorgan Vale basking in 5.2kW/m²/day of solar radiation (equivalent to 18.70MJ/m²/day), home charging becomes remarkably cost-effective. A typical 6kW solar system could fully charge a Tesla Model 3’s 60kWh battery in two sunny days – effectively making your commute emissions-free. For the BMW 5 Series PHEV’s smaller 17.6kWh battery, daily top-ups using solar could slash charging costs by up to 80% compared to grid power.
